Our MMC products are designed and manufactured to be of superlative quality; higher specific modulus allows for a lighter and stiffer design, while use of significantly improved material properties at higher temperatures delivers lighter, more durable pistons.


The reinforced MMC structure minimises wear at critical interfaces, compared to more conventional piston materials, and offers a lower coefficient at thermal expansion. This, in turn, results in better control of clearances across operating temperatures. Higher thermal conductivity underscores the lighter, more reliable design features of our pistons, which are precisely the qualities that keep our customers coming back time and again for engine pistons on which they can depend.
